    Complete the sentences
     
1.   A young cow is a ______.
2.   The plural of mouse is ______.
3.   Cows, sheep, and ______ produce milk that people drink.
4.   A ______ is like a small horse with long ears.
5.   A ______ is like a mouse, but is larger.
6.   A ______ lives in or near water, and can jump.
7.   A bull is the adult ______ of the cow family.
8.   A ______ is a group of cows.
9.   A ______ is a large bird, similar to a chicken, that can be eaten.
10.   The general word for bulls and cows on a farm is ______.
11.   A goat often has two ______ on its head.

    Answers
     
1.   A young cow is a calf.
2.   The plural of mouse is mice.
3.   Cows, sheep, and goats produce milk that people drink.
4.   A donkey is like a small horse with long ears.
5.   A rat is like a mouse, but is larger.
6.   A frog lives in or near water, and can jump.
7.   A bull is the adult male of the cow family.
8.   A herd is a group of cows.
9.   A turkey is a large bird, similar to a chicken, that can be eaten.
10.   The general word for bulls and cows on a farm is cattle.
11.   A goat often has two horns on its head.
